Output 839e508967266cae096be556986c33e5664504df70d0dcc06477d6e3aa942f3c:9

value
65536
script pubkey
OP_0 OP_PUSHBYTES_20 87627bbf242d187227ed6cce28de2c552e921b43
address
tb1qsa38h0ey95v8yflddn8z3h3v25hfyx6rwvhx6l
transaction
839e508967266cae096be556986c33e5664504df70d0dcc06477d6e3aa942f3c